Clerk

Complete user management and authentication platform for modern applications

Clerk is a developer tools and infrastructure service that provides complete user management and authentication platform for modern applications. Founded in 2019 and headquartered in San Francisco, California, Clerk offers 3 pricing plans. It offers a free tier as well as paid plans starting from $25/month. Key features include Authentication, User management, Multi-factor auth, Social login. Clerk is a popular choice for users looking for quality development subscriptions.

Peacock

NBCUniversal streaming with live sports and news

Peacock is a streaming and entertainment service that provides nbcuniversal streaming with live sports and news. Founded in 2020 and headquartered in New York, New York, Peacock offers 3 pricing plans. It offers a free tier as well as paid plans starting from $7.99/month. Key features include Live sports, NBC shows, Peacock Originals, Next-day episodes. Peacock is a popular choice for users looking for quality entertainment subscriptions.
